A: The Ledgerpine job compares warehouse counts from the Marrowgate scanners against the Stockweave database snapshot. If a scanner uploads late, the snapshot is stale and the job flags items that were actually moved correctly. These self-resolve on the next run. Before investigating, check the scanner upload timestamps and confirm the snapshot completed. Genuine discrepancies persist across two runs. The step-by-step verification guide is kept on the internal page here.

operations page: https://jenkins.zemvarcloud.local/job/merge_requests/repo/build/73930b4b30f0a8ed

Alert: KioskPulse Watchdog Restart Loop. The watchdog process on Brightstall kiosks restarted the shell app more than three times within ten minutes, which usually indicates a crash loop rather than a transient hang. Please review the restart backoff logic in the watchdog module before approving any hotfix, since an overly aggressive timer can mask memory leaks in the renderer. Capture the last three crash dumps and forward them for triage to the address below.

escalation mailbox, hadug-bajog: sormir@norvalabs.internal

The Fennwick library catalogue import runs nightly from the Shelfwright feed. Ownership: ingestion pipeline — Data Services; MARC field mapping — Metadata Guild; dedupe logic — the Lattice team. Failed runs page Data Services automatically; partial imports do not, so check the morning digest. Mapping disputes go to Metadata Guild, not the pipeline folks. Schema changes need sign-off from both. For anything touching the dedupe thresholds, or if ownership is unclear, raise it at sync or write to the import maintainers.

escalation mailbox, bafog-fafog: ulador@paliqlabs.internal